    My 07 Nomad, when loaded down with me, daughter, 3 day pack, and all the "just in case" junk in the bags, I used to put my shocks up near the max in the 35 psi range. This gave a bit of a rough ride, but rolling through switchbacks in the mountains, the suspension would not wallow or compress to the point I would be tearing up hard parts if there was a dip in the road.. Normally run a few PSI over ambient. I did also tie both of my shocks together with an air crossover so there was 1 fill point (that did not require the bags to be removed to check or fill) and both were automatically equal. It makes a huge difference when you understand how to work with the suspension to get the effect you need for the ride you are on.
